Is 124/80 Normal Bp With 102 Pulse Rate?

I went to walmart to have my blood pressure checked. It was 124/80 with 102 pulse rate. I had just eaten at Subway and walked and pushed the buggy all over walmart. I am a 36 year old female. I don't smoke and don't drink alcohol. Is this normal?

As your Blood pressure is absolutely normal.pulse rate is 102/min seems to be higher than the normal.

as your BP and pulse rate recorded during your active movement phase. so while you on active physical movement heart rate will be increased. nothing to be worried.if you are overweight or obese pulse rate will be higher than the normal.
it is a physiological action.it is normal.
kindly check your Pulse rate after a 15 mins rest both physically and mentally.to know your resting pulse rate.
